Not constitution, BJP agenda being followed across country: Mehbooba

‘Centre beating drums on Art 370 abrogation, fails to address grave issues of poverty, others’

Srinagar, Nov 06 (KNO): The former chief minister and PDP chief,  Mehbooba Mufti on Friday said that the government doesn’t follow the constitution but the agenda of Bhartiya Janata Party (BJP) the country

Addressing party workers in Jammu today,  Mehbooba as per the news agency—Kashmir News Observer (KNO) said that the incumbent regime in the centre is beating drums on abrogation of Article 370, but fails to provide benefits to the people and eradicate the poverty on the ground.

“Keeping in view of poverty in the country, the government instead of going for a lockdown they should have taken steps that would have suit the poor nation,” she said, adding that on the day of calling for ‘Thali Bajao’, Prime Minister should have informed people to get ready for lockdown so that the poor nation could have prepared themselves for the period.

Mehbooba also said that she has reached Jammu to talk to the people like her father Late Mufti Muhammad Sayeed was doing as the then chief minister.

“Beating drums on abrogation of Article 370 was the only thing the present regime is doing. However, it has failed to bring some respite to the people from poverty,” she said, adding that the special status to J&K was given by Maharaja Hari Singh, but the present regime has demolished the constitution.

PDP chief also stated that the BJP government in centre was following its party agenda rather than country’s constitution—(KNO)
